What are the primary responsibilities of a Vendor Cafe attendant during a typical shift?

As a Vendor Cafe attendant, your main responsibilities include preparing and serving food and beverages, accurately handling customer transactions, maintaining cleanliness of the cafe area, and ensuring compliance with health and safety standards. You may also be responsible for restocking supplies and occasionally assisting with inventory control. Collaboration with kitchen staff and other team members is common, particularly during peak service times. Successfully managing a fast-paced environment while providing friendly and efficient service is key to this role.

How do vendor cafe jobs work?

Vendor cafe jobs typically involve preparing and serving food or beverages in a cafe setting, often requiring customer service skills and knowledge of food safety standards. Employees usually work scheduled shifts, may need to handle cash or POS systems, and sometimes require food handler certifications depending on the location. The roles can include baristas, cooks, or cashiers, with responsibilities varying by establishment.

Job description

TITLE:  Café Lead                                     DEPARTMENT:  Café

 

STATUS: FT/PT, Union, Hourly          REPORTS TO:  Café Manager

 

JOB SUMMARY: To ensure the highest level of service possible to Outpost’s internal and external customers. Order product to maintain a fully stocked department.  Ensure a well maintained, clean and efficient café department.

 

WORK ENVIRONMENT:  Fast paced retail floor and cafe. Work near moving mechanical parts (i.e. coffee/juice machines, slicer) and in cold/hot climate conditions (i.e. cooler or near stove). Ability to work in moderate and loud noise environments including, but not limited to: computers, paging, telephones, human voices, and machinery. Position requires working during busy retail times, which include weekends, afternoons, and evenings.

 

 

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ITES:

1.  Customer Service

  1. Treat people fairly, consistently, and with respect.
  2. Ensure efficient, informative, and friendly service according to established customer service vision and standards.

2.  Café Department Responsibilities

Department Operations

  1. Ensure customers are all greeted and assisted in timely manner.
  2. Expedite customer orders with kitchen.
  3. Ensure customers receive their orders in a timely manner and have what they need to enjoy their dining experience.
  4. Handle customer questions and complaints.
  5. Check out customer’s purchases quickly and accurately, using correct prices, codes and departments.
  6. Provide samples and information of the products sold in the department.
  7. Follow sanitary guidelines with regards to food handling, serving, and storing.
  8. Maintain department displays, cases and work areas.
  9. Ensure all prepared foods display areas are properly fronted and faced.
  10. Ensure proper shelf tags and sale signs are on products and displays.
  11. Request signs from pricing as needed.
  12. Ensure department and seating areas are kept neat, clean, and stocked.
  13. Follow proper procedures in opening, closing, and maintaining all café areas including: juice bar, cold case, hot case, salad bar, sandwich bar, bakery case, and seating areas.
  14. Order product from vendors and commissary to ensure department if fully stocked, while keeping inventory to a minimum.
  15. Receive and stock orders. Check condition of product and invoice accuracy for all deliveries. Ensure correct product rotation.
  16. Assist in inventory control including: accurate recording of losses, markdowns, and transfers.
  17. Maintain a clean and organized backstock area remembering to rotate.
  18. Advise café manager of equipment repair/replacement needs.
  19. Backup café kitchen staff when needed.
  20. Attend department meetings as scheduled.
  21. Perform all duties included in department clerk job descriptions.

Personnel

  1. Delegate duties to café staff and ensure they are always busy.
  2. Positively encourage department staff to excel at their job.
  3. Replace vacant shifts when call ins, etc. occur.  Notify manager of these occurrences.
  4. Assist in training department staff.
  5. Assist café staff in following department standard operating procedures.
